You should aim for a 0 value when the engine is at normal operating temperature. Most engines will
not require extra fuel after 100-140 degrees F. The values should decrease in a fairly linear fashion
from cold to operating temperature then have 0's entered above this threshold. Temperatures can be
displayed in F or C.
As a reference, a value of 127 would add 50% to the pulse width and a 255 entered will double the
pulse width.
By flicking back between Gauge 1 mode and ENGINE TEMPERATURE you can make adjustments
while the engine is warming up. Each time the EM-5 updates to a new ET in gauge mode, you can go
to that ENGINE TEMPERATURE range in the programmer. Now turn the knob richer and leaner and
note where the engine starts to run rough on each side of 12 o’clock. If it runs rough say at 10 and 2
o’clock, you probably have the engine temp values about right. If not, adjust the ENGINE TEMP value
at the engine temp displayed currently in Gauge1 mode.
Start (START)
Start enrichment is provided for under the START and START CYCLES parameters. The EM-5 reads
the signal from the engine temperature sensor, looks up the START value at that temperature range,
and injects extra fuel for a certain number of engine cycles after the EM-5 detects crank rotation. This
function is activated every time that the engine is started, no matter what the engine temperature is.
However, if there is a zero at the current temperature range, no extra fuel will be added. START
values are critical for proper starting, especially in cold climates.
At colder temperatures, the values are high, tapering off as the engine warms up. At temperatures
over 100 to 140°F, most engines do not require much extra fuel so the values should be low or 0 here.
Experimentation is required for a satisfactory setup here.
It is best to not open the throttle during cranking, especially in cold temperatures. Opening the
throttle will cause a leaner mixture during cranking. The engine needs a rich mixture to start.
Tuning all the START values will take many days in very cold climates. You can usually only tune one
value per day, and you will have to wait for colder weather to adjust the colder ranges.
Systems will do 1 injection of fuel at key-on, when the Start value is greater than 0 at any
temperature. This will improve cold starting.
Aviation systems have special software to allow manual priming without the engine turning over. You
may stroke the throttle a few times in cold conditions to open the injectors momentarily. This acts just
like a primer and may aid starting in very cold climates. Close the throttle when cranking, even if
you prime.
Start Cycles
The value entered under START CYCLES determines how many engine cycles START enrichment
lasts for. This is the number of crank revolutions times 2 on a 4 stroke engine. Some engines require
start enrichment lasting a long time, others only require a short start enrichment period. The larger the
value under START CYCLES, the longer the enrichment period. This is adjustable between 0 and
255, but a value of 40 is probably as high as you would ever need, and do not set this below 10
because too low a value will make the START function expire too quickly.
